Fanfare Ciocarlia

Sunday, September 23, 2012 | 6:00 pm

Sarah P. Duke Gardens


Fanfare Ciocarlia, the world’s hottest Gypsy brass band, vamps on traditional Romanian dance tunes with “raucous good humor” (NY Times). A wedding combo from an isolated Romanian town turned world-touring phenomenon, the 12-piece ensemble barrels headlong through local traditions spiked with contemporary influences. With searing brass, throbbing percussion, and incantatory group vocals in Romani, Fanfare Ciocarlia cannot be contained in a concert hall. For fans of Gogol Bordello — or anyone who might enjoy dancing under the moonlight at Duke Gardens — this is a sure shot rarely seen on U.S. stages.
